Sherborne Train Station is well-equipped to ensure a comfortable experience for travelers. With ticket machines available, you can easily purchase tickets or collect ones you've bought online. While the station doesn't issue smartcards, it does have validators in place.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access provided to both platforms via ramps. Although the station lacks a waiting room, it compensates with seating areas and accessible toilets found on Platform 1.
If you're in need of assistance, station staff are available during set hours, and help points are strategically placed for added convenience. The station also sports modern amenities like public Wi-Fi hotspots, ensuring connectivity on the go. Although there are no shops or ATMs on-site, a delightful café offers a respite for refreshments.
Travelling beyond Sherborne is an easy affair with several onward travel options. The station is complemented by bus services with detailed journey planning information readily available. In the event of rail disruptions, a reliable rail replacement service picks up right outside the station. Greenfield Station opens its ticket office from 06:50 to 14:25 on weekdays and more leisurely hours on Saturdays. Those catching an early or late train might find solace in the available ticket machines, which are friendly to both traditional and online purchases. An induction loop is installed for those with hearing impairments, ensuring clear communication. Although the station is classified as a Category B station—meaning it has partial step-free access—it does provide wheelchair ramps for train access. However, those needing more complete accessibility should plan in advance as some sections may require assistance due to stairways.
Your connection to the wider world doesn't end at the train station. Greenfield provides convenient links to local buses with services available on Shaw Hill Bank Road catering to travel toward Ashton. For those unpredictable moments of rail disruptions, rail replacement services pick up conveniently outside the station's entrance. While Greenfield lacks its own taxi rank, local cab services can be accessed through this service, making it easy to plan a smooth, onward journey.

In absence of waiting lounges, Greenfield station does include seating areas for those brief waits. Parking is generously available and free of charge, equipped with CCTV for added security. The station may not have shopping or refreshment facilities, but its proximity to the village can lead you to some local delights.
